APGA Southwest Extends Warm Greetings to Muslim Community as Ramadan Continues

 

APGA SOUTHWEST EXTENDS WARM GREETINGS TO MUSLIM COMMUNITY AS RAMADAN CONTINUES

 


By Wole Adedoyin

 

As Muslims worldwide observe the holy month of Ramadan, the Southwest chapter of the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A) has extended its heartfelt greetings to the Muslim community.

 

APGA Southwest acknowledged the significance of Ramadan as a time for spiritual growth, self-discipline, and compassion. Muslims devote themselves to fasting, prayer, and charitable acts, fostering a sense of unity and empathy within their communities.

 

Alhaji Owolabi Suraj Olanrewaju, the National Vice Chairman (Southwest) of APGA, emphasized the importance of unity and understanding during Ramadan. He highlights its role in bringing people together and expresses APGA Southwest's commitment to promoting interfaith dialogue and celebrating the country's rich diversity.

 

Extending greetings to the Muslim community, APGA Southwest reaffirmed its dedication to inclusivity, tolerance, and the principles of justice and equality. Ramadan serves as a reminder of the shared values that unite humanity, transcending differences and promoting empathy and compassion.

 

APGA Southwest encouraged everyone to reflect on the universal lessons of Ramadan – empathy, generosity, and gratitude. These values are especially important in today's world, offering hope and inspiration for a more compassionate and equitable future.

 

The Southwest chapter recognized the significant contributions of the Muslim community to Nigeria's cultural, social, and economic fabric.

 

APGA Southwest called on individuals of all faiths and backgrounds to join in solidarity with Muslims during Ramadan, offering support and understanding.
